1. Which part of Medicare primarily covers inpatient hospital
care?
A. Part B
B. Part C
C. Part D
D. Part A
Correct Answer: D. Part A
Rationale: Medicare Part A helps cover inpatient hospital stays,
skilled nursing facility care, hospice care, and some home
health services.
2. Medicare Part B generally covers which of the following?
A. Prescription drugs
B. Physician services and outpatient care
C. Long-term custodial care
D. Dental care
Correct Answer: B. Physician services and outpatient care
,Rationale: Part B covers medically necessary physician services,
outpatient care, preventive services, durable medical
equipment, and laboratory tests.
3. Medicare Part D is designed primarily to provide coverage
for:
A. Hospital stays
B. Hospice care
C. Prescription drugs
D. Nursing home care
Correct Answer: C. Prescription drugs
Rationale: Medicare Part D helps beneficiaries pay for
outpatient prescription medications.
4. Medicare Advantage plans are also known as:
A. Medigap Plans
B. Medicare Supplement Plans
C. Medicare Part C Plans
D. Medicaid Plans
Correct Answer: C. Medicare Part C Plans
Rationale: Medicare Advantage (Part C) combines Part A and
Part B benefits and often includes prescription drug coverage.
,5. Which organization administers the Medicare program?
A. Social Security Administration
B.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S)
C. Department of Labor
D. Internal Revenue Service
Correct Answer: B.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services
(CMS)
Rationale: CMS administers Medicare and establishes
regulations governing Medicare plans.
6. Most individuals become eligible for Medicare at what age?
A. 60
B. 62
C. 65
D. 67
Correct Answer: C. 65
Rationale: Most individuals qualify for Medicare upon reaching
age 65, although some qualify earlier because of disability or
certain diseases.
, 7. Which individual may qualify for Medicare before age 65?
A. Any retired worker
B. A person receiving Social Security Disability benefits for the
required period
C. Any unemployed person
D. Any veteran
Correct Answer: B. A person receiving Social Security Disability
benefits for the required period
Rationale: Individuals receiving SSDI benefits for the qualifying
period may become eligible before age 65.
8. Original Medicare consists of which two parts?
A. Part A and Part B
B. Part A and Part D
C. Part B and Part D
D. Part C and Part D
Correct Answer: A. Part A and Part B
Rationale: Original Medicare includes hospital insurance (Part
A) and medical insurance (Part B).
